The SFP9, a firing pin lock pistol with polymer grip in caliber 9 x 19 mm , replaces the hitherto guided HK P7. The grip-tensioning pistol of the same caliber entered Bavarian service in 1979 and was also the standard weapon in Lower Saxony, Saxony, at the GSG 9 and in the bodyguards of the Feldjägertruppe.
